Output 59412de6f7eaf847b828f0cbdb155bf18410ff119c97a7ac29c7d27e33fdffc7: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d76f0c99d635fa78abb682c9b270cde5cd7dc76 OP_EQUAL
address
3Eb1gjB9ZSAqBG5yXrYqswhfi78VoSVaNc
transaction
59412de6f7eaf847b828f0cbdb155bf18410ff119c97a7ac29c7d27e33fdffc7
spent
true